Hands skin is exposed to cold and sunlight, dry air and abrasive washing and cleaning liquids and powders. Our nails are the extension of hands skin. These harmful conditions damage nails as well. They become thin and brittle. Almond oil is a rich source of essential fatty acids, healing vitamins and minerals. It can help rejuvenate and heal brittle and dry fingernails.

Composition of almond oil

A wide variety of vitamins, fatty acids, minerals and other ingredients of almond oil can benefit our body and nails for the inside if almond oil is consumed and from outside when almond oil is topically applied, as Wikipedia states. Almond oil is high in Vitamin E, a natural antioxidant. This vitamin provides protection to nails and skin from sun damage and helps heal cracked, dry and damaged cuticles of fingernails.Almond oil also contains Vitamin B2 and Vitamin B6. When the body lacks them, dry areas and cracks appear on the skin (the sebaceous glands don’t work properly), hair and nails become weak and brittle.

Strengthening brittle nails

Fingernails as well as the skin should be moisturized and nourished. Almond oil may help keep them strong and healthy, it nourishes nails and their cuticles, prevents moisture loss, according to Beauty Cosmetic Guide. Vitamins and minerals in almond oil assist in nails growth. They help nails avoid brittleness and breakage.

Application of almond oil for nail

  1. When you use almond oil for nails, apply concentrated almond oil, never dilute it with water. Almond oil has a light texture; it is absorbed quickly and won’t leave a greasy feeling.
  2. Apply a little bit of almond oil onto a cotton pad and massage the oil into cuticles, nails and under each nail for several minutes.
  3. Use almond oil at least twice a day for 10-14 days to get results.

Considerations

Sometimes the growth of nails is slowed down when people are on a very strict diet or suffer from certain diseases accompanied metabolism and blood circulation disruption. Consult your doctor in case your nails grow slowly despite application of almond oil.
